Ingredients

Scale
  • 1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il
  • 1 onion (diced)
  • 1 bell pepper (diced)
  • 4 cloves garlic (minced)
  • 3 roma tomatoes (finely diced) or 8 oz tomato sauce
  • 4 boneless skinless chicken thighs (cut into pieces)
  • 2 cups Spanish rice
  • 5 cups chicken broth
  • 1/2 lb jumbo shrimp (peeled)
  • 1/2 lb mussels (cleaned)
  • 8 oz calamari rings
  • Pinch of saffron threads
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
  2. Sauté onion, bell pepper, and garlic until the onion is translucent.
  3. Stir in tomatoes, bay leaf, paprika, saffron, salt, and pepper; cook for 5 minutes before adding white wine.
  4. Add chicken pieces and rice; mix well.
  5. Pour in chicken broth without stirring; bring to a boil.
  6. Reduce heat to medium-low and cook uncovered for about 15 minutes.
  7. Nestle shrimp, mussels, and calamari into the mixture; sprinkle peas on top.
  8. Cook for an additional 5 minutes until most liquid is absorbed.
  9. Remove from heat, cover with a lid or foil, and let rest for 10 minutes before serving.
